Posted By: <b>Geno</b><p>I think Lee meant black or red! The three different backs are Black with Factory 649 or 30, or Red with Factory 30. If anybody has anything else, I'd love to know!<br /><br />Geno

Posted By: <b>Brian H (misunderestimated)</b><p>Lee-<br />Don't rely too heavily on the Pop reports (any company) cards are often submitted multiple times and in general the better players (this holds for just about every vintage set) are more likely to be submitted regardless of condition. <br /><br />My sense is that while knowledge about the scarce cards in a given vintage set is relatively specialized knowledge, who was a great (or even good) player -- especially HOFers -- is more widely known so those cards tend to be submitted more often.<br /><br />Also, I'll try to get you info about the backs of my cards in the near future.
